The Special Collections Library in Albuquerque, NM, is dedicated to preserving and providing access to research collections focused on the history and culture of Albuquerque and New Mexico. Housed in a historic 1925 Pueblo Spanish Revival-style building, this library is an essential resource for those interested in local history, anthropology, and the arts.

In addition to its extensive collections, the library offers various public amenities including meeting rooms, public computers, and free wireless internet access. It also hosts a range of engaging events, such as speaker series and library tours, aimed at educating the community about local heritage and the significance of written history.
